I didn't get it quite right and my boolits are a little too small. Putting the cherry back in and turning by hand didn't do anything so I tried something else. I put the mould in the freezer for a few hours. Then I heated the cherry a little and with a chuck on it for a handle, I turned it in the cold mould.
It worked and the boolit is where I want it. I have to shoot some yet and will let you know how it did.
For any of you that are making your own, it is a lot easier then starting all over.
